I’ve been looking forward to reading this book since seeing the sneak peek and I have not been left disappointed! I love stories centred around Bletchley Park and its history. I have not read a Rhian Tracey book before and this story follows on from its predecessor (which I will now be reading) which was based around three young people working at Bletchley Park during World War 2. This book moves away from Bletchley to Wales following a teenager called Ned who wants to escape his domineering father so travels with his mum to a secret location for an important job. They are looking after artwork from the National Gallery which is being kept in a slate mine on the side of a mountain hoping to keep it hidden from the enemy which is not easy to do….
I love stories that are based on true events. The author has created characters that are easy to like and there is great attention to detail which really brings it to life. I have already given the book to my son to read as it is a great way of introducing young readers to World War 2 history. I will definitely be recommending it for our school library.
I haven’t read the first book in this series but will definitely add it to my collection. I thoroughly recommend this book and I look forward to reading further books by this author.
